Black PepperI'm always getting small nicks and cuts on my hands or arms ... sometimes other places but usually from those sharp edges around hose clamps. I can't seem to look at a hose clamp sideways without getting cut. Then of course, I bleed ... since aspirin is a regular part of my diet, I bleed a lot. Usually, all over anything and everything; my clothes, the new rug, boat cushions ... if you look close enough at my boat you'll find enough blood stains for an episode of CSI. I've found that usually, a liberal application of black pepper to the cut, stops the bleeding right away packing it down into the cut helps some too. Sometimes the pepper rubs off or sweats off and so I'll have to reapply it but I haven't found a better local coagulant AND it doesn't sting like you think it would ... totally painless. Then you need to sweep up the excess black pepper or the admiral gets after you but not as bad as when I get blood on the curtains or something. |
